A heat engine (which every internal combustion engine is!) has a maximum theoretical efficiency defined by the Carnot heat engine model which by thermodynamics is always less than 100% and typically much MUCH lower. And cars and truck are not powered by idealized theoretical heat engine models, they are powered by big ugly gasoline drinking inefficient actual realizations of a heat engine.

Wikipedia has a great page on the internal combustion engine, and in particular relating to it's efficiency (or lack thereof):

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Internal_combustion_engine#Energy_efficiency

Wherein Wikipedia says "Even when aided with turbochargers and stock efficiency aids, most engines retain an average efficiency of about 18%-20%." So that means out of $100 you put in your gas tank, most is already gone and wasted R/T inherent inefficiency so we have about $20 worth to work with to provide real usable work.
